Maintenance Tips For Longevity

Preserving decorative concrete outdoors demands routine care to secure its lifespan and aesthetic quality. First and foremost, periodic cleaning with a mild soap solution helps prevent the buildup of debris and grime. It is advisable to employ a pressure washer from time to time, but care is necessary to prevent damage to the surface. Sealing the concrete at regular intervals protects it from dampness and discoloration, enhancing its durability. Additionally, prompt attention to fractures or chips is critical; utilizing a quality repair compound can halt continued degradation. In the winter months, using a de-icing product that is concrete-friendly minimizes freeze-thaw damage. Finally, keeping heavy machinery off decorative surfaces protects their durability and appearance. These maintenance practices ensure that exterior decorative concrete remains beautiful and resilient over time.

Care for Your Concrete Surfaces the Right Way

A well-maintained concrete surface can significantly improve the visual and practical appeal of any space. Regular maintenance is essential to prolong the life of concrete, guaranteeing it remains both sturdy and attractive. Cleaning serves as the initial step; employing a broom or pressure washer helps clear away dirt and debris. For difficult stains, a mild detergent can be effective.

Sealing the surface is another critical aspect. A high-grade sealant provides protection from moisture, oils, and stains, reducing the likelihood of cracking and discoloration. Reapplying the sealer every few years is strongly suggested, based on the level of wear and tear.

Additionally, handling cracks as soon as they appear avoids more extensive harm. Applying suitable sealants to minor cracks provides a reliable solution. As a final point, keeping aggressive chemicals and heavy machinery away from the surface supports the long-term durability of the surface. By following these guidelines, homeowners can ensure their concrete surfaces stay in optimal shape for the long term.

How Much Time Does Concrete Need to Cure Before Use?

The full curing process for concrete takes approximately 28 days, with the initial set taking place within 24 to 48 hours. Throughout this time, the concrete builds strength, which makes it important to refrain from heavy use until it has properly cured.

Is It Possible to Install Concrete Over Existing Flooring?

Yes, concrete is able to be laid over your current floor surface, so long as the surface is debris-free, clean, and structurally sound. Thorough preparation ensures a durable bond and reduces the risk of unevenness or surface inconsistencies in the completed surface.

What Should I Do if My Concrete Develops Cracks?

When concrete develops cracks, the primary step is to evaluate the damage. Clean the area thoroughly, then use an appropriate filler to seal the cracks. For severe damage, consulting a professional for repairs is advisable.

Are Environmentally Friendly Concrete Options Available?

Yes, eco-friendly concrete options exist, such as recycled materials, pervious concrete designed for water drainage, and low-carbon cement alternatives. These alternatives minimize environmental impact while preserving durability and performance, making them attractive to environmentally conscious consumers and builders alike.

How Does Weather Affect the Concrete Installation Process?

Weather factors considerably affect concrete installation. Temperature extremes, moisture, and wind conditions are known to influence cure time, concrete strength, and long-term integrity. Optimal circumstances usually consist of moderate temperatures and low humidity, ensuring best results for the concrete.
